The Structure of the Gravitational Lens System B1152+199

P. G. Edwards, J. E. J. Lovell, H. Hirabayashi, D. L. Jauncey and S. Toft

Publications of the Astronomical Society of Australia 18(2) 172 - 175

Abstract

Received 2001 February 2, accepted 2001 April 11

We have commenced a program to monitor the gravitational lens B1152+199 with the Australia Telescope Compact Array (ATCA) to search for variability of the lensed components with the goal of measuring the lensing time delay. As part of this program we made a 9 hour full-synthesis observation in June 2000 to derive a ‘template’ for model-fitting the shorter, multi-epoch, monitoring observations. We report here on the results of this full-synthesis observation and on three additional epochs of monitoring for time variation.
